Transforming Steps – Campaigns and Events

In order to promote mental health and wellbeing and to raise awareness on gender-based-violence, KS constantly engages in organizing campaigns and events in an effort to create a public engagement platform on the topics. We do this through the medium of art, festivals, and performances.

Purpose
  • To awaken and engage communities through creative wellbeing
  • To raise awareness and mobilize action on wellbeing and gender justice

We strive to-

  • Run campaigns and festivals with a purpose
  • Normalize mental-health discourse
  • Promote self-care and collective care

Silence and stigma curb community action on gender based violence (GBV) and mental health; creative approaches unlock participation.

We aim to address the problems of-

  • Limited open dialogue and low engagement
  • Fragmented networks around wellbeing

Art becomes a civic tool—connecting people, building empathy, and sparking collaboration.
